David Disseldorp 485e21729b scsi: target: Fix XCOPY NAA identifier lookup
commit 2896c93811 upstream.

When attempting to match EXTENDED COPY CSCD descriptors with corresponding
se_devices, target_xcopy_locate_se_dev_e4() currently iterates over LIO's
global devices list which includes all configured backstores.

This change ensures that only initiator-accessible backstores are
considered during CSCD descriptor lookup, according to the session's
se_node_acl LUN list.

To avoid LUN removal race conditions, device pinning is changed from being
configfs based to instead using the se_node_acl lun_ref.

Reference: CVE-2020-28374

Ying-Tsun Huang a9d49da7ed x86/mtrr: Correct the range check before performing MTRR type lookups
commit cb7f4a8b1f upstream.

In mtrr_type_lookup(), if the input memory address region is not in the
MTRR, over 4GB, and not over the top of memory, a write-back attribute
is returned. These condition checks are for ensuring the input memory
address region is actually mapped to the physical memory.

However, if the end address is just aligned with the top of memory,
the condition check treats the address is over the top of memory, and
write-back attribute is not returned.

And this hits in a real use case with NVDIMM: the nd_pmem module tries
to map NVDIMMs as cacheable memories when NVDIMMs are connected. If a
NVDIMM is the last of the DIMMs, the performance of this NVDIMM becomes
very low since it is aligned with the top of memory and its memory type
is uncached-minus.

Move the input end address change to inclusive up into
mtrr_type_lookup(), before checking for the top of memory in either
mtrr_type_lookup_{variable,fixed}() helpers.

Charan Teja Reddy ef8133b1b4 dmabuf: fix use-after-free of dmabuf's file->f_inode
commit 05cd84691e upstream.

It is observed 'use-after-free' on the dmabuf's file->f_inode with the
race between closing the dmabuf file and reading the dmabuf's debug
info.

Consider the below scenario where P1 is closing the dma_buf file
and P2 is reading the dma_buf's debug info in the system:

P1						P2
					dma_buf_debug_show()
dma_buf_put()
  __fput()
    file->f_op->release()
    dput()
    ....
      dentry_unlink_inode()
        iput(dentry->d_inode)
        (where the inode is freed)
					mutex_lock(&db_list.lock)
					read 'dma_buf->file->f_inode'
					(the same inode is freed by P1)
					mutex_unlock(&db_list.lock)
      dentry->d_op->d_release()-->
        dma_buf_release()
          .....
          mutex_lock(&db_list.lock)
          removes the dmabuf from the list
          mutex_unlock(&db_list.lock)

In the above scenario, when dma_buf_put() is called on a dma_buf, it
first frees the dma_buf's file->f_inode(=dentry->d_inode) and then
removes this dma_buf from the system db_list. In between P2 traversing
the db_list tries to access this dma_buf's file->f_inode that was freed
by P1 which is a use-after-free case.

Since, __fput() calls f_op->release first and then later calls the
d_op->d_release, move the dma_buf's db_list removal from d_release() to
f_op->release(). This ensures that dma_buf's file->f_inode is not
accessed after it is released.

Filipe Manana 64d06c7f2f btrfs: send: fix wrong file path when there is an inode with a pending rmdir
commit 0b3f407e67 upstream.

When doing an incremental send, if we have a new inode that happens to
have the same number that an old directory inode had in the base snapshot
and that old directory has a pending rmdir operation, we end up computing
a wrong path for the new inode, causing the receiver to fail.

Example reproducer:

  $ cat test-send-rmdir.sh
  #!/bin/bash

  DEV=/dev/sdi
  MNT=/mnt/sdi

  mkfs.btrfs -f $DEV >/dev/null
  mount $DEV $MNT

  mkdir $MNT/dir
  touch $MNT/dir/file1
  touch $MNT/dir/file2
  touch $MNT/dir/file3

  # Filesystem looks like:
  #
  # .                                     (ino 256)
  # |----- dir/                           (ino 257)
  #         |----- file1                  (ino 258)
  #         |----- file2                  (ino 259)
  #         |----- file3                  (ino 260)
  #

  btrfs subvolume snapshot -r $MNT $MNT/snap1
  btrfs send -f /tmp/snap1.send $MNT/snap1

  # Now remove our directory and all its files.
  rm -fr $MNT/dir

  # Unmount the filesystem and mount it again. This is to ensure that
  # the next inode that is created ends up with the same inode number
  # that our directory "dir" had, 257, which is the first free "objectid"
  # available after mounting again the filesystem.
  umount $MNT
  mount $DEV $MNT

  # Now create a new file (it could be a directory as well).
  touch $MNT/newfile

  # Filesystem now looks like:
  #
  # .                                     (ino 256)
  # |----- newfile                        (ino 257)
  #

  btrfs subvolume snapshot -r $MNT $MNT/snap2
  btrfs send -f /tmp/snap2.send -p $MNT/snap1 $MNT/snap2

  # Now unmount the filesystem, create a new one, mount it and try to apply
  # both send streams to recreate both snapshots.
  umount $DEV

  mkfs.btrfs -f $DEV >/dev/null

  mount $DEV $MNT

  btrfs receive -f /tmp/snap1.send $MNT
  btrfs receive -f /tmp/snap2.send $MNT

  umount $MNT

When running the test, the receive operation for the incremental stream
fails:

  $ ./test-send-rmdir.sh
  Create a readonly snapshot of '/mnt/sdi' in '/mnt/sdi/snap1'
  At subvol /mnt/sdi/snap1
  Create a readonly snapshot of '/mnt/sdi' in '/mnt/sdi/snap2'
  At subvol /mnt/sdi/snap2
  At subvol snap1
  At snapshot snap2
  ERROR: chown o257-9-0 failed: No such file or directory

So fix this by tracking directories that have a pending rmdir by inode
number and generation number, instead of only inode number.

Chandana Kishori Chiluveru 2768282218 usb: gadget: configfs: Preserve function ordering after bind failure
commit 6cd0fe9138 upstream.

When binding the ConfigFS gadget to a UDC, the functions in each
configuration are added in list order. However, if usb_add_function()
fails, the failed function is put back on its configuration's
func_list and purge_configs_funcs() is called to further clean up.

purge_configs_funcs() iterates over the configurations and functions
in forward order, calling unbind() on each of the previously added
functions. But after doing so, each function gets moved to the
tail of the configuration's func_list. This results in reshuffling
the original order of the functions within a configuration such
that the failed function now appears first even though it may have
originally appeared in the middle or even end of the list. At this
point if the ConfigFS gadget is attempted to re-bind to the UDC,
the functions will be added in a different order than intended,
with the only recourse being to remove and relink the functions all
over again.

An example of this as follows:

ln -s functions/mass_storage.0 configs/c.1
ln -s functions/ncm.0 configs/c.1
ln -s functions/ffs.adb configs/c.1	# oops, forgot to start adbd
echo "<udc device>" > UDC		# fails
start adbd
echo "<udc device>" > UDC		# now succeeds, but...
					# bind order is
					# "ADB", mass_storage, ncm

Fix this by reversing the iteration order of the functions in
purge_config_funcs() when unbinding them, and adding them back to
the config's func_list at the head instead of the tail. This
ensures that we unbind and unwind back to the original list order.

Dexuan Cui 9e60056b1f video: hyperv_fb: Fix the mmap() regression for v5.4.y and older
db49200b1d is backported from the mainline commit
5f1251a48c ("video: hyperv_fb: Fix the cache type when mapping the VRAM"),
to v5.4.y and older stable branches, but unluckily db49200b1d causes
mmap() to fail for /dev/fb0 due to EINVAL:

[ 5797.049560] x86/PAT: a.out:1910 map pfn expected mapping type
  uncached-minus for [mem 0xf8200000-0xf85cbfff], got write-back

This means the v5.4.y kernel detects an incompatibility issue about the
mapping type of the VRAM: db49200b1d changes to use Write-Back when
mapping the VRAM, while the mmap() syscall tries to use Uncached-minus.
That’s to say, the kernel thinks Uncached-minus is incompatible with
Write-Back: see drivers/video/fbdev/core/fbmem.c: fb_mmap() ->
vm_iomap_memory() -> io_remap_pfn_range() -> ... -> track_pfn_remap() ->
reserve_pfn_range().

Note: any v5.5 and newer kernel doesn't have the issue, because they
have commit
d21987d709 ("video: hyperv: hyperv_fb: Support deferred IO for Hyper-V frame buffer driver")
, and when the hyperv_fb driver has the deferred_io support,
fb_deferred_io_init() overrides info->fbops->fb_mmap with
fb_deferred_io_mmap(), which doesn’t check the mapping type
incompatibility. Note: since it's VRAM here, the checking is not really
necessary.

Fix the regression by ioremap_wc(), which uses Write-combining. The kernel
thinks it's compatible with Uncached-minus. The VRAM mappped by
ioremap_wc() is slightly slower than mapped by ioremap_cache(), but is
still significantly faster than by ioremap().

Change the comment accordingly. Linux VM on ARM64 Hyper-V is still not
working in the latest mainline yet, and when it works in future, the ARM64
support is unlikely to be backported to v5.4 and older, so using
ioremap_wc() in v5.4 and older should be ok.

Note: this fix is only targeted at the stable branches:
v5.4.y, v4.19.y, v4.14.y, v4.9.y and v4.4.y.

Hans de Goede 84d488719b Bluetooth: revert: hci_h5: close serdev device and free hu in h5_close
commit 5c3b579686 upstream.

There have been multiple revisions of the patch fix the h5->rx_skb
leak. Accidentally the first revision (which is buggy) and v5 have
both been merged:

v1 commit 70f259a3f4 ("Bluetooth: hci_h5: close serdev device and free
hu in h5_close");
v5 commit 855af2d74c ("Bluetooth: hci_h5: fix memory leak in h5_close")

The correct v5 makes changes slightly higher up in the h5_close()
function, which allowed both versions to get merged without conflict.

The changes from v1 unconditionally frees the h5 data struct, this
is wrong because in the serdev enumeration case the memory is
allocated in h5_serdev_probe() like this:

        h5 = devm_kzalloc(dev, sizeof(*h5), GFP_KERNEL);

So its lifetime is tied to the lifetime of the driver being bound
to the serdev and it is automatically freed when the driver gets
unbound. In the serdev case the same h5 struct is re-used over
h5_close() and h5_open() calls and thus MUST not be free-ed in
h5_close().

The serdev_device_close() added to h5_close() is incorrect in the
same way, serdev_device_close() is called on driver unbound too and
also MUST no be called from h5_close().

This reverts the changes made by merging v1 of the patch, so that
just the changes of the correct v5 remain.
